
Four in Critical Condition After Consuming Poisonous Mushrooms in Keonjhar
Keonjhar, June 25(OT Webdesk): Four members of a family from Balia village, under Anandapur subdivision in Odisha’s Keonjhar district, were hospitalised in critical condition on Tuesday after allegedly consuming wild mushrooms foraged from nearby forests.
According to locals, the family unknowingly ingested what doctors now suspect to be toxic mushrooms. Within hours of their meal, all four exhibited symptoms including vomiting, dizziness, and unconsciousness.
Alerted by the situation, neighbours rushed them to the Anandapur Sub-Divisional Hospital.
Medical staff are monitoring their condition, which remains serious but stable. Mushroom samples have been sent for laboratory testing to confirm toxicity.
In response, district authorities have launched a public awareness campaign, urging residents to avoid consuming unfamiliar wild mushrooms.
Officials emphasised the importance of educating rural communities about food safety risks posed by toxic fungi.
This incident highlights recurring challenges in rural healthcare awareness and underscores the need for improved food literacy at the grassroots level.
Investigations into the exact mushroom species involved are ongoing.
